Integrated Chemical Engineering I
MIT OpenCourseWare offers the course materials for this chemical engineering class, which covers reaction kinetics, batch reactor analysis, and batch distillation as the entry point into process design. Students work through batch operations scheduling and safety analysis while learning to use the ABACUSS process simulator to model and test chemical processes before they exist in hardware. The course is built around case-style problem sets that push students to apply kinetics and reactor theory to realistic plant scenarios rather than abstract equations alone. Materials include lecture notes, assignments, and simulator exercises, published under MIT's open license for self-paced study.
